| Form 990, Part VI, Section A, line 6 | The club is composed of members who must be elected to the membership by a resident member and seconded by two resident members, all of whom shall know the nominee personally, but none of whom shall be related to the nominee by blood or marriage-by being a second cousin or closer. The nomination shall be posted by the Secretary of the Club and remain there for ten days. During that time, members may furnish the Board and Membership Committee with confidential information relating to the qualification of any nominee for membership. The nomination shall then be taken from the bulletin board by the Secretary and delivered to the Membership Committee for investigation. The recommendation of the Membership Committee shall be reported by it to the President, by whom it shall be reported to the Board of Directors at the next meeting of the Board. Voting shall be by secret ballot. |
| Form 990, Part VI, Section A, line 7a | The governing body is the Board of Directors and the Board is elected to two year terms by members. |
